    Rajflyboy

    You may be new to late model dirt racing - I don’t know? But davenport’s team- Double LL Motorsports owned by Lance Landers of Batesville, Arkansas is probably the 2nd most well funded team in all of late models. When established it was called the “Dream Team.” Lance dumps heavy amount of $$ into this team and Steve Martin with Nutrian-Ag Solutions (previously Crop Production Services) is a heavy hitter as far as sponsorship. So make no bones about it- Johnathan Davenports team wants for nothing when it comes to money.
